Using Prezi to get students engaged in learning
Just been using Prezi in class to get students presenting information in a logical order. They signed up for a free account at www.prezi.com and managed to work out how to use it very quickly. It's quite a bit more engaging than PowerPoint. We were working through chapter 2 of Mill's essay On Liberty and had just read his 'infallibility argument' for freedom of thought and discussion. It didn't take them long to put together some really good presentations. What's even better is that they are able to embed their presentations in their blog (a simple case of embedding the html code in a blog post).
